MY FATHER HAD PURCHASED A BUILDING IN UP VILLAGE FROM A RELATIVE BY JUST MAKING A SALE AGREEMENT ON RS 20 STAMP PAPER MENTIONED THEREIN THAT HE WILL DO REGISTRY AFTER ALL PAYMENT. MY FATHER ALSO TAKEN POSSESSION FROM HIM AND VISIT AND LEAVE THERE FROM TIME TO TIME BUT THE SELLER HAD NOT DONE REGISTRY BUT NOW AFTER 11 YEARS NOW MY RELATIVE HAD BROKEN LOCK AND TAKE POSSIONED OF HOUSE AND SAYING THAT HE HAD NOT SELL HOUSE. MY FATHER ALSO CONSTRUCTED ONR MORE FLOOR ABOVE THE PURCHASED BUILDING. ONLY WATER CONNECTION WAS IN NAME OF MY MOTHER.SALE AGREEMENT IS BETWEEN MY MOTHER AND RELATIVE. WE HAD DONE HALF PAYMENT IN CASH AND HALF BY CHEQUE. PLEASE SUGGEST ME THE LEGAL REMEDY AVAILABLE TO ME.
Vijay Raj Mahajan (Expert) 03 March 2018
You have no right in the property that was never sold to your father through registered conveyance deed after paying proper Stamp duty and property tax as per the circle rate of the district where the property was located.
If you constructed any floor on the property it was on your own risk.
The water bill is in the name of your mother doesn't make her the lawful owner of the property.
Mere sale agreement on Rs 20 non-judicial stamp paper if makes any one owner of property worth lakhs of Rupees than everyone in the country will be owning each and every inch of land in the country.
